Synopsis "Incarnate"

Some mothers believe their children are destined for greatness. Lara Joyner believes her son is the Second Coming of Christ.

Guided by whispers she hears in the wind, signs in the clouds, and revelations in her Tarot cards, Lara is certain that young Dale has been chosen to save humanity. And as the mother of God, she believes she too is destined for glory beside the Almighty. But before the world can witness his divinity, Dale must learn to perform miracles-and Lara will stop at nothing to awaken his power.

Dale, however, is only trying to survive. If pretending to be Jesus keeps his mother calm, perhaps he can protect himself and his younger brother Louie from the terrifying unpredictability of her unraveling mind. As Lara's visions grow darker and more dangerous, the boys are swept into a frightening world where faith and delusion blur beyond recognition.

While their desperate father and older sister race to find them, Dale and Louie must navigate a childhood overshadowed by paranoia, fear, and the crushing weight of prophecy.

Haunting and deeply human, Incarnate is a gripping psychological novel based on a true story about the devastating power of belief, the fragility of reason, and the fierce resilience of children fighting to endure the unimaginable.
